  • 2-2. Underlying Technology

  • The technology behind ChatGPT is built on the Generative Pre-trained Transformer (GPT) models, specifically GPT-3.5 and GPT-4. GPT-3.5 and GPT-4 utilize deep-learning algorithms that help the system learn from vast amounts of training data. The models leverage supervised learning, where initial outputs are generated based on pre-existing data, and reinforcement learning with human feedback (RLHF) to refine those outputs over time. This process of continuous feedback helps enhance the accuracy and quality of the responses generated by ChatGPT. ChatGPT's ability to understand and generate human-like text makes it a versatile tool for various applications, including answering complex questions, providing recommendations, and translating languages.

4. Comparison with Alternatives

  • 4-1. ChatGPT vs. Microsoft Copilot

  • ChatGPT and Microsoft Copilot are both generative AI solutions built using large language models and OpenAI technology. Despite their similarities, they serve distinct purposes. ChatGPT is a conversational AI model designed for a broad range of tasks, from content creation to customer service. It is available in three forms: Free ChatGPT, ChatGPT Plus (a premium subscription with advanced features), and ChatGPT Enterprise (offering enhanced security and administrative tools for businesses). ChatGPT's functions include composing essays, emails, and codes, with multi-modal capabilities such as responding to visual prompts and browsing the internet for information. In contrast, Microsoft Copilot is tailored for the Microsoft ecosystem, enhancing productivity and efficiency within tools like Word, Outlook, PowerPoint, Excel, and Teams. It incorporates user data from Microsoft 365 to provide personalized and contextual responses. Microsoft Copilot is available as an add-on to existing Microsoft 365 packages, focusing on business productivity rather than generalized content creation.

  • 4-2. Other Popular AI Assistants

  • In addition to ChatGPT and Microsoft Copilot, there are numerous other AI assistants widely used in various contexts. For instance, OtterPilot is an AI meeting assistant that records audio, writes notes, and generates summaries, integrating with platforms like Zoom and Google Meet. Fireflies.ai also serves as a meeting assistant, offering functionalities like call recording, transcription, and searchable transcripts. Murf AI is a text-to-speech generator popular for creating voice-overs and dictations, offering a range of customizable voices. Apple’s Siri, known for its natural language interface, is highly personalized and integrated across Apple devices. Microsoft’s Cortana works with Windows platforms and integrates with Alexa for smart device control. Amazon Alexa uses NLP for tasks like creating to-do lists and providing real-time information. Google Assistant is a versatile tool available on many devices, offering features like real-time translation and voice-activated control. ELSA Speak and Socratic are notable for their educational uses, providing speech recognition for language learning and homework assistance, respectively.

  • 6-2. Limitations of Current Versions

  • Despite its benefits, ChatGPT has several limitations. The document 'ChatGPT App - Get ChatGPT on your cell phone' notes that the AI chatbot is unavailable as an official app for Android users, forcing them to rely on web access. Additionally, ChatGPT's responses are constrained by its training data, which only extends up to 2021, making it challenging to generate content with current facts or trends. As mentioned in '7 most popular ChatGPT Apps that are worth trying,' ChatGPT cannot generate images directly; users must switch to another OpenAI platform, DALL-E, for visuals. ChatGPT also lacks support for voice commands, limiting its usability for tasks that would benefit from hands-free interaction.
